CAS 110655-58-8
:CINNAMYCIN
Description:
Cinnamycin, with the CAS number 110655-58-8, is a polypeptide antibiotic produced by the bacterium *Streptomyces cinnamoneus*. It is known for its antimicrobial properties, particularly against Gram-positive bacteria. Cinnamycin exhibits a unique mechanism of action by binding to the lipid II component of bacterial cell walls, thereby inhibiting cell wall synthesis. This antibiotic is characterized by its cyclic structure, which contributes to its stability and efficacy. Cinnamycin is also notable for its potential applications in treating infections caused by resistant bacterial strains. In addition to its antibacterial activity, research has indicated that cinnamycin may possess antitumor properties, making it a subject of interest in cancer research. Its solubility in organic solvents and limited solubility in water are important characteristics that influence its formulation and delivery in therapeutic applications. Overall, cinnamycin represents a significant compound in the field of medicinal chemistry, particularly in the development of new antibiotics and anticancer agents.
